The courts of the judicial district of Castellón will have five additional judges from June 2027, with the aim of relieving the workload overload that the judicial bodies currently face.
The councilor of Justice, Transparency and Participation, Nuria Martínez, announced that three of the new positions will be destined for the civil section, one for the court of first instance and another for the commercial court.
Despite this approval, the Generalitat Valenciana, through the Council, claims from the Ministry of Justice the attribution of more resources to face the needs of justice in the region.
